Hi, > 4 Input tied to ground.supply > 4 Is free BUT can cause bad problems if software is changed. I would NEVER do that ! I have seen a product ( Thanks God it was not mine ! ) from a client that just blew 200 boards in a cold month because of that !!!! It was poorly designed in every way I can think of and was very sensitive to EMI. The ports changed state from input to output and the chips just blew apart. I agree that if the other aspects of the design were better thought that should not happen often but I can't see any advantages of tying the pin to ground !! Pull-ups or down are the best if you can afford it, if not just leave the ports as outputs. There is nothing to be gained by relying on the internal pullups or tying the pin to ground or VCC.
